Skip to content

Releases: ghdl/ghdl

Nightly Release

11 May 23:02
Compare
Choose a tag to compare
Nightly Release Pre-release
Pre-release

This nightly release contains all latest and important artifacts created by GHDL's CI pipeline.

GHDL 6.0.0-dev

GHDL offers the simulator and synthesis tool for VHDL. GHDL can be build for various backends:

  • gcc - using the GCC compiler framework
  • mcode - in memory code generation
  • llvm - using the LLVM compiler framework
  • llvm-jit - using the LLVM compiler framework, but in memory

The following asset categories are provided for GHDL:

  • macOS x64-64 builds as TAR/GZ file
  • macOS aarch64 builds as TAR/GZ file
  • Ubuntu 24.04 LTS builds as TAR/GZ file
  • Windows builds for standalone usage (without MSYS2) as ZIP file
  • MSYS2 packages as TAR/ZST file

Docker Images

Latest docker images at pushed to Docker Hub - ghdl/ghdl:latest.

pyGHDL 6.0.0-dev

The Python package pyGHDL offers Python binding (pyGHDL.libghdl) to a libghdl shared library (*.so/*.dll).
In addition to the low-level binding layer, pyGHDL offers:

  • a Language Server Protocol (LSP) instance for e.g. live code checking by editors
  • a Code Document Object Model (CodeDOM) based on pyVHDLModel

The following asset categories are provided for pyGHDL:

  • Platform specific Python wheel package for Ubuntu incl. pyGHDL...so
  • Platform specific Python wheel package for Windows incl. pyGHDL...dll
  • Platform specific Python wheel package for Windows + MSYS2 (MinGW64, UCRT64) incl. pyGHDL...dll

Published from Build, Package and Test GHDL workflow triggered by @Paebbels on 2025-05-11 22:58:52 UTC.

v5.0.1

01 Mar 17:39
Compare
Choose a tag to compare

GHDL 5.0.1

GHDL offers the simulator and synthesis tool for VHDL. GHDL can be build for various backends:

  • gcc - using the GCC compiler framework
  • mcode - in memory code generation
  • llvm - using the LLVM compiler framework
  • llvm-jit - using the LLVM compiler framework, but in memory

The following asset categories are provided for GHDL:

  • macOS x64-64 builds as TAR/GZ file
  • macOS aarch64 builds as TAR/GZ file
  • Ubuntu 24.04 LTS builds as TAR/GZ file
  • Windows builds for standalone usage (without MSYS2) as ZIP file
  • MSYS2 packages as TAR/ZST file

Docker Images

Latest docker images at pushed to Docker Hub - ghdl/ghdl:latest.

pyGHDL 5.0.1

The Python package pyGHDL offers Python binding (pyGHDL.libghdl) to a libghdl shared library (*.so/*.dll).
In addition to the low-level binding layer, pyGHDL offers:

  • a Language Server Protocol (LSP) instance for e.g. live code checking by editors
  • a Code Document Object Model (CodeDOM) based on pyVHDLModel

The following asset categories are provided for pyGHDL:

  • Platform specific Python wheel package for Ubuntu incl. pyGHDL...so
  • Platform specific Python wheel package for Windows incl. pyGHDL...dll

Published from Build, Package and Test GHDL workflow triggered by @tgingold on 2025-03-01 17:37:34 UTC.

v4.1.0

14 Apr 17:57
Compare
Choose a tag to compare
release 4.1.0

v4.0.0

06 Mar 21:33
Compare
Choose a tag to compare
release 4.0.0

v3.0.0

08 Mar 07:38
Compare
Choose a tag to compare
release 3.0.0

v2.0.0

01 Mar 02:53
Compare
Choose a tag to compare
release 2.0.0

v1.0.0

02 Feb 21:08
Compare
Choose a tag to compare
release 1.0.0

v0.37

28 Feb 20:58
Compare
Choose a tag to compare

Downloads (all):
Downloads of GHDL v0.37

v0.36

03 Mar 08:49
Compare
Choose a tag to compare

Downloads (all):
Downloads of GHDL v0.36

20181129

29 Nov 20:06
Compare
Choose a tag to compare
20181129 Pre-release
Pre-release
snapshot